Signs and Symptoms

A person with dry eye syndrome may experience signs and symptoms, which usually affect both eyes, as under:

  • Dry, sandy/gritty/scratchy, or filmy feeling
  • Burning or itching
  • Intermittent excessive tearing
  • Stringy mucus in or around your eyes
  • Redness of the eyes
  • Sharp or achy pain in or around the eyes
  • Eye fatigue
  • Blurred or double vision
  • Foreign body sensation
  • Light sensitivity
  • Difficulty wearing contact lenses
  • Difficulty with night time driving
